The Longmont City Council has opened their bi-annual recruitment to fill vacancies on City boards and commissions. This is a great opportunity to make your voice heard and take a more active role in your community. Please consider applying.
Who can make the difference? It’s you!
Participants volunteer their time and advise City Council on a wide variety of issues that affect the safety, economy, and quality of life of Longmont’s residents and businesses.
Applications are now being accepted for vacancies on the following:
- Airport Advisory Board
- Art in Public Places Commission
- Board of Adjustment & Appeals
- Golf Course Advisory Board
- Library Advisory Board
- Master Board of Appeals
- Museum Advisory Board
- Sustainability Advisory Board
- Transportation Advisory Board
- Water Board
Update: Planning and Zoning Commission will not be recruiting for a vacancy until the end of the year.
Board members typically spend a few hours a month preparing for and attending meetings. Most boards require applicants to be a registered voter in Longmont and to reside inside Longmont city limits for at least one year prior to being appointed.
